I purchased a business/store 30 years ago from my parents. I have the contract of sale. My husband and I have put in 16 hour days for 30 years building up this business to the successful business it is today. The business is located on the ground floor of what is my parents residence. There are several apartments in this building. One of which my parents occupied.
My parents also gave me a lease on the business, which expired several years ago. Before it expired, my mother renewed the lease for an additional 25 years. My siblings did not know about this newly extended lease. My mother was of sound mind and body and did this graciously and legally for me. My father had passed on before this. There are approximately 22 years left on the current lease. Shortly after the first lease expired, my mother informed my siblings about the newly extended lease. This is when our trouble began.
To make a long story short, within a few months of the new lease being revealed, my mother and I were threatened by my siblings to rip up the lease. My mother refused and insisted that this was exactly what my father and she wanted for me.
Days later, my mother had completely changed her disposition. Being influenced by my siblings, she too insisted I rip up the lease and threatened to disown me. All of my family soon stopped speaking to me completely when I refused.
Three years have past, and my mother has now passed on. It has now been revealed to us that approximately two months after my family stopped speaking to me, my mother had changed her will. She had taken me out of the will completely.
I have a copy of her original will of which I am included. I am now in the process of challenging the validity of this newly created will.
I would appreciate and suggestions and/or opinions on where I stand in this case and where I should go from here.
